simple harmonic motion

From Wiktionary, the free dictionary

Remove ads

English

Noun

simple harmonic motion (plural simple harmonic motions)

  1. (mathematics, mechanics) oscillating motion (as of a pendulum) in which the acceleration of the oscillator has an equal magnitude but opposite direction to the displacement of it from the equilibrium position.
